Needle coke for anode is a high-purity, carbon-rich material derived from petroleum or coal feedstocks, distinguished by its highly ordered, needle-like crystalline structure. It offers excellent electrical conductivity, low thermal expansion, and strong graphitization capability, making it suitable for high-performance carbon applications. The main product types of needle coke for anode include petroleum-based needle coke and coal-based needle coke. Petroleum-based needle coke refers to highly crystalline carbon material derived from petroleum feedstock and used in the production of anodes and graphite-based components. The surge in electric vehicle (EV) production is expected to propel the growth of the needle coke for anode market going forward. Electric vehicles are battery-powered transportation systems that use lithium-ion batteries as their primary energy storage mechanism to enable propulsion without internal combustion engines. The rise in electric vehicle (EV) production is mainly driven by strict government emission regulations, as tighter carbon and fuel standards compel automakers to shift from internal combustion engines to cleaner electric mobility. Needle coke for anodes supports EV production by supplying high-purity carbon materials required for manufacturing graphite anodes that enhance battery efficiency and performance. For instance, in January 2024, according to a report published by Kelley Blue Book, a US-based Cox Automotive company, in 2023, a record 1.2 million car buyers in the United States chose electric vehicles, which accounted for 7.6% of the entire U.S. vehicle market, up from 5.9% in 2022. Major companies operating in the needle coke for anode market are focused on forming strategic partnerships to develop integrated production facilities that combine needle coke and synthetic graphite manufacturing, enabling a more efficient and secure supply chain for lithium-ion battery anodes. Strategic collaborations support technology transfer, large-scale project execution, and the production of high-quality carbon materials essential for electric vehicle and energy storage applications. For instance, in May 2023, Chevron Lummus Global LLC, a US-based provider of refining and petrochemical process technologies, partnered with TAQAT Development Company, a Saudi Arabia-based industrial project developer, to announce a license and engineering agreement for establishing a needle coke and synthetic graphite complex. This project aims to produce advanced carbon materials, where needle coke serves as a key precursor for synthetic graphite, which is widely used as an anode material in lithium-ion batteries, thereby strengthening the battery materials' value chain.What Are Latest Mergers And Acquisitions In The Needle Coke For Anode Market?
In September 2025, Epsilon Advanced Materials, an India-based battery materials company, partnered with Phillips 66 to secure a long-term supply of needle coke feedstock for its graphite anode production facility in North Carolina. Through this partnership, Epsilon Advanced Materials aims to ensure a stable supply of green and calcined needle coke, enabling large-scale production of synthetic graphite anodes and supporting the growing demand for electric vehicle batteries.
